Who Will Sing for Me?
Who Will Sing for Me (Time 2:56)

The song is credited to Thomas J Farris in 1944. However, it is possible that an earlier version existed decades before. The story behind the lyrics remains unknown, however it is a song that has been recorded by many artists ranging from the Grateful Dead to Emmylou Harris.

My Approach to Recording Who Will Sing for Me

This is a very interesting song to play and record. On one hand Farris is writing about death and being alone. On the other, I believe it’s also a song of contentment if not happiness. My goal was to use instruments which lightened the message and made it flow (so mandolin backing up a guitar). I also used a slightly quicker tempo than normal.
